首页
学习
活动
专区
工具
TVP
发布
社区首页 >问答首页 >使用非JS REST API的Javascript服务器渲染库

使用非JS REST API的Javascript服务器渲染库
EN

Stack Overflow用户
提问于 2018-01-17 05:17:51
回答 2查看 66关注 0票数 0

是服务器渲染的框架/库(例如用于React的Nextjs、用于Vue的Nuxt )和非JS REST API后端(即Java、Django、Go等)。它们是相互排斥的,还是可以同时使用?

具体地说,我正在使用Go在后端构建REST API,我想知道是否必须放弃它,让页面由服务器呈现。

EN

回答 2

Stack Overflow用户

回答已采纳

发布于 2018-01-17 05:37:32

实际上,这是两个不同的关注点: Vue和React是JavaScript框架。它们不能在基于Go的服务器应用程序上运行。

没有什么可以阻止您在Go应用程序中呈现超文本标记语言,但是Go服务器不会运行JavaScript框架。如果是这样的话,它可能需要额外的脚手架,在这一点上,您还可以设置一个NodeJS服务器来处理渲染这些路由。

票数 0
EN

Stack Overflow用户

发布于 2018-01-21 11:37:11

即使您同时使用JavaScript和use a separate API server with next.js,我们也鼓励您使用JavaScript。无论是在服务器端还是在浏览器渲染,让next.js应用程序与其进行对话是很常见的。

如果您想将它们放在同一个域中,以便可以直接使用cookie,您可以在now.sh中使用path aliases,这是来自Zeit的类似Heroku的PaaS,它是Next.js的开发者。可以在使用now-server进行开发时对其进行设置。这也可以使用nginx、apache、netlify和CloudFront中的反向代理,或者使用亚马逊网络服务的应用程序负载均衡器中的基于路径的路由。

票数 1
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/48289992

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档